Anyone else not excited about the holidays?

Asked by jordym84 (4752points) November 15th, 2012

Growing up I always used to look forward to the holiday season. I have a big family and each year we would gather at a different relatives’ home on Christmas Eve for a big dinner and then, at midnight, open up our presents. However, my number one favorite thing about the holiday season was that special warm, fuzzy, happy feel in the air during the weeks preceding Christmas. Back in my home country holiday decor is not up until 2 weeks before Christmas and, traditionally, everything comes down on January 6th (Day of the Kings as its known in my culture, or Epiphany in the US), but now that I live in the US, by the time Christmas comes around I’m so desensitized that it just doesn’t feel special anymore…everything just feels overdone and overly commercialized. Especially in Orlando, with the theme parks and all, which start putting up Christmas stuff the day after Halloween (the super Walmart close to where I live had holiday stuff up on the shelves the second week of October!!).

I’m sure I’m not the only one who feels this way, but I’m just curious to know everyone else’s take on the sudden influx of holiday-themed…everything…which normally starts right around the first week of November. Do you like it? Hate it? Or do you just not care either way?
